Research project: Urinary catheter ‘fill and flush’ valve: safety, effectiveness, acceptability and feasibility trial

Currently Active: 
Yes

Indwelling urinary catheters are widely used medical devices that are associated with many problems including urinary tract infection. In the Bladder and Bowel Management Group, our objective is to undertake a ‘first in human trial’ of a novel urinary catheter valve aimed at reducing infection.

A novel urinary catheter valve has been developed with the purpose of allowing the bladder to fill and automatically intermittently empty. The valve has been tested in the laboratory and will now be tested for usability and acceptability with long term catheter users.
